Understanding Your Requirements

The first step in selecting a fertilizer spreading tractor is to clearly identify your operational requirements. Consider the size of your farm, the type of crops you're growing, and the specific fertilizers you plan to use. Different scenarios may require different tractor specifications.

Assess Your Farm Size and Terrain

For larger farms, a tractor with higher horsepower and larger capacity will typically be more beneficial. Conversely, for smaller plots of land, compact tractors can provide greater maneuverability and cost efficiency. Additionally, the terrain can also dictate your choice; hilly or uneven landscapes may necessitate tractors with advanced traction capabilities and stability.

Choosing the Right Spreader Type

Fertilizer spreaders come in various types, including broadcast and drop spreaders. The choice largely depends on the tractor size and the type of fertilizer you use. Broadcast spreaders are excellent for covering large areas quickly, while drop spreaders allow for more precise application, reducing waste and environmental impact.

Compatibility with Your Tractor

Ensure that the fertilizer spreader is compatible with your chosen tractor model. It’s essential to check the attachment system and hydraulic requirements. Some spreaders require specific hydraulic setups that may not be standard across all tractor models.

Evaluate Performance Features

Your tractor should have features that enhance performance, particularly when it comes to spreading fertilizers. Look for adjustable spread widths and flow rates, which provide control over the amount of fertilizer distributed and help reduce excess use.

Power and Efficiency

Horsepower is a critical factor that influences not just performance but also fuel efficiency. A more powerful tractor can handle larger spreaders and work over rough terrain more effectively, which can save on operational time and costs in the long run.

Maintenance and Durability

Considering the long-term investment of a fertilizer spreading tractor, maintenance requirements should not be overlooked. Look for tractors that are known for their durability and ease of maintenance, as these factors will reduce downtime and service costs.

Supplier Support and Warranty

Choosing a supplier that offers strong customer support can make a significant difference in your overall satisfaction. Inquire about warranty options and after-sales services to ensure you receive timely assistance in case of any issues with your tractor or spreader.

Customer Reviews and Industry Recommendations

Before making a final decision, it is advisable to read customer reviews and seek recommendations from other farmers. Insights from those who have used the tractor you are considering can provide valuable information about its performance, reliability, and overall user satisfaction.

Trial and Demonstration

If possible, request a demonstration or trial period. Hands-on experience will allow you to assess the tractor’s performance in real-world conditions, ensuring it meets your expectations and operational requirements.
